The RDO Equipment Co. Aberdeen store is in our Midwest Agriculture division, which sells and services John Deere agriculture machinery and parts. One of five stores in South Dakota, RDO's Aberdeen location primarily serves crop and livestock farmers in the surrounding areas. What You Will Do:
Build Strong Customer Relationships: Develop and maintain strong, long-term partnerships with customers across your assigned territory to support their operational success.
Drive Product Support Sales: Promote and sell maintenance services, repair parts, extended warranties, and other solutions that maximize customer uptime and business performance.
Deliver Customer Solutions: Identify customer needs and provide tailored recommendations backed by a solid understanding of products and services.
Stay Informed: Represent the company on-site, including occasionally testing or operating equipment as needed to support customer needs.
Collaborate & Grow: Work closely with internal teams, participate in meetings and training, and continuously develop your skills and knowledge.
